How To Set Who You Want To See Your Friends List?

1. You must be logged in to your Facebook Timeline account;

2. Then from the default News Feed page, click your name to redirect you to your Facebook Timeline profile page;

Facebook Timeline Profile Link

3. Underneath your Facebook Timeline cover photo, click your “Friends” box;

Facebook Timeline Friends List

4. Once your Friends page loaded, move your mouse to the Edit button;

Facebook Timeline Edit button

5. You can select which options you want to choose to set who you want to see your Friends list. You can select either Public, Friends, Only Me (it means you :) ), Custom (specify friends you want to allow to view your Friends’ list, or even customized it more by setting or creating a group.

Facebook Timeline Friends Viewing Setup

Basically, that’s all you need to do to set or configure your Facebook Timeline.
